Understanding and Managing the Biotechnology Valley of Death
1School of Management and Florey Institute, University of Sheffield, Sheffield, UK; Science Technology Studies Laboratory, ISSEK, Higher School of Economics, Moscow, Russia.
Abstract:
Biotechnology has a Valley of Death challenge. Arrhenius's model is used to consider this journey by visualizing the factors critical to identifying appropriate business models. Examples illustrate this interplay and the routes to industrial readiness. The insights provided are useful to research and development managers, policy makers, entrepreneurs, and biotechnologists.
